Opleiding Mind Mapping®
- formation par NCOI Learning
- Louvain, Hasselt, Gand
Discover the simple but ingenious principles of "Warnier" in this three-day ABIS training.
This course treats the so-called "data-structured programming design" of Warnier and Jackson. Especially for programs that process huge volumes of data, e.g. in a database context, a data-driven approach is beneficial, and actually common practice. Moreover, this gives guarantees of correctness to software components which use this approach, thereby simplifying the task of application testing considerably.
At the end of this course, the participant:
Classroom instruction with exercises (70% of the time). This course can be tuned to the programming standards of your company.
Delivered as a live, interactive training – available in-person or online, or in a hybrid format. Training can be implemented in English, Dutch, or French.
Basic knowledge of a programming language. The most popular languages used in data-driven context are COBOL (see COBOL programming - part 1), PL/I (see PL/I programming: fundamentals course), PL/SQL (cf. course PL/SQL database programming), and SQL PL (cf. course SQL PL and SQL/PSM database programming).
First of all, COBOL or PL/I programmers who want to improve the structure and maintenance of their programs. Also any programmer, analyst, or application designer confronted with a complex data-oriented problem setting for which a readable and correctly functioning implementation is needed. This certainly applies to any non-interactive programs accessing relational databases. In that sense, an other important target audience of this course are PL/SQL and SQL PL programmers.